0
  • 聊天消息
  • 系统消息
  • 评论与回复
登录后你可以
  • 下载海量资料
  • 学习在线课程
  • 观看技术视频
  • 写文章/发帖/加入社区
创作中心

完善资料让更多小伙伴认识你,还能领取20积分哦,立即完善>

3天内不再提示

mysql数据库的增删改查sql语句

科技绿洲 来源:网络整理 作者:网络整理 2023-11-16 15:41 次阅读

MySQL是一种常用的关系型数据库管理系统,是许多网站和应用程序的首选数据库。在MySQL中,我们可以使用SQL(结构化查询语言)进行数据的增删改查操作。本文将详细介绍MySQL数据库的增删改查SQL语句,以帮助读者全面了解MySQL的基本操作。

一、增加数据

在MySQL数据库中,我们可以使用INSERT语句来向表中插入新的数据。INSERT语句的基本语法如下:

INSERT INTO table_name (column1, column2, column3, ...)
VALUES (value1, value2, value3, ...);

其中,table_name是要插入数据的表名,column1, column2, column3等是要插入数据的列名,value1, value2, value3等是要插入的具体值。

例如,我们有一个名为students的表,包含学生的学号、姓名和年龄等信息,我们可以使用以下SQL语句向该表中插入一条新的学生信息:

INSERT INTO students (student_id, name, age)
VALUES (1, 'Tom', 20);

这样就向students表中插入了一条学生信息,学号为1,姓名为Tom,年龄为20。

二、删除数据

在MySQL中,我们可以使用DELETE语句来删除表中的数据。DELETE语句的基本语法如下:

DELETE FROM table_name
WHERE condition;

其中,table_name是要删除数据的表名,condition是删除数据的条件。

例如,我们要删除students表中学号为1的学生信息,可以使用以下SQL语句:

DELETE FROM students
WHERE student_id = 1;

这样就会删除students表中学号为1的学生信息。

三、更新数据

在MySQL中,我们可以使用UPDATE语句来更新表中的数据。UPDATE语句的基本语法如下:

UPDATE table_name
SET column1 = value1, column2 = value2, ...
WHERE condition;

其中,table_name是要更新数据的表名,column1, column2等是要更新的列名,value1, value2等是要更新的具体值,condition是更新数据的条件。

例如,我们要将students表中学号为1的学生年龄更新为22,可以使用以下SQL语句:

UPDATE students
SET age = 22
WHERE student_id = 1;

这样就将students表中学号为1的学生年龄更新为22。

四、查询数据

在MySQL中,我们可以使用SELECT语句来查询表中的数据。SELECT语句的基本语法如下:

SELECT column1, column2, ...
FROM table_name
WHERE condition;

其中,column1, column2等是要查询的列名,table_name是要查询的表名,condition是查询的条件。

例如,我们要查询students表中年龄大于18的学生信息,可以使用以下SQL语句:

SELECT student_id, name, age
FROM students
WHERE age > 18;

这样就会查询出students表中年龄大于18的学生信息。

除了基本的SELECT语句外,MySQL还提供了许多其他的查询语句,如使用DISTINCT关键字去重查询、使用ORDER BY关键字对结果进行排序、使用GROUP BY关键字进行分组查询等。

总结:

本文详细介绍了MySQL数据库的增删改查操作的SQL语句。通过INSERT语句可以向表中插入新的数据,通过DELETE语句可以删除表中的数据,通过UPDATE语句可以更新表中的数据,通过SELECT语句可以查询表中的数据。读者可以根据自己的需求灵活运用这些SQL语句来操作MySQL数据库。希望本文能够对读者理解和掌握MySQL数据库的增删改查操作提供帮助。

声明:本文内容及配图由入驻作者撰写或者入驻合作网站授权转载。文章观点仅代表作者本人,不代表电子发烧友网立场。文章及其配图仅供工程师学习之用,如有内容侵权或者其他违规问题,请联系本站处理。 举报投诉
  • SQL
    SQL
    +关注

    关注

    1

    文章

    738

    浏览量

    43461
  • 数据库
    +关注

    关注

    7

    文章

    3591

    浏览量

    63369
  • MySQL
    +关注

    关注

    1

    文章

    775

    浏览量

    26003
收藏 人收藏

    评论

    相关推荐

    mysql数据库操作指南

    mysql数据库sql语句基础知识
    发表于 09-18 09:06

    如何在本地电脑中输入access数据库路径,对它进行增删改

    各位大佬好,麻烦指导下如何在本地电脑中通过输入access数据库路径,对它进行增删改
    发表于 01-03 09:49

    labview多程序同时访问数据库闪退问题

    用labview访问数据库,连接,增删改都没问题。但当我再两个循环中都对数据库进行操作时,程序要么卡着不动了,要么闪退。经排查是当两个循环中同时执行
    发表于 01-19 15:50

    labview多程序同时访问数据库程序卡死问题

    用labview访问数据库,连接,增删改都没问题。但当我再两个循环中都对数据库进行操作时,程序要么卡着不动了,要么闪退。经排查是当两个循环中同时执行
    发表于 01-19 15:51

    使用jpa和thymeleaf做增删改示例

    【本人秃顶程序员】springboot专辑:springboot+jpa+thymeleaf增删改示例
    发表于 04-01 11:49

    如何用php调用mysql数据库实现增删改

    php调用mysql数据库实现增删改
    发表于 04-09 12:53

    python是如何实现hbase增删改

    hbase shell是怎样去创建命名空间的?python是如何实现hbase增删改的?求解
    发表于 10-19 07:26

    MySQL数据库Access存储读取SQL语句

    LabVIEW视频教程MySQL数据库Access存储读取SQL语句
    发表于 10-21 11:59

    鸿蒙应用java开发,使用jdbc连接云服务器mysql数据库报错怎么解决

    AbilitySlice { //sql数据库连接字符串 private static final String URL="jdbc:mysql://服务器的host/cameraDemo
    发表于 04-02 10:54

    最实用的SQL语句快来收藏学习吧

    文章沿着设计一个假想的应用 awesome_app 为主线,从零创建修改数据库,表格,字段属性,索引,字符集,默认值,自增,增删改查,多表查询,内置函数等实用 SQL 语句。收藏此文,
    的头像 发表于 12-21 11:04 3055次阅读

    如何用Python对数据库中的数据进行增删改

    pyhton如何连接mysql数据库 1、导入模块 2、打开数据库连接 3、创建游标对象cursor 如何用Python对数据库中的数据进行
    的头像 发表于 08-05 10:22 7714次阅读

    SQLite数据库增删改

    SQLite数据库增删改查  SQLite是一种轻量级的RDBMS(关系型数据库管理系统),具有速度快、易用性高等优点。虽然SQLite数据库相对于一些大型
    的头像 发表于 08-28 17:09 839次阅读

    mysql增删改语句以及常用方法

    MySQL是一种热门的关系型数据库管理系统,广泛用于各种Web应用程序和企业级应用程序中。本文将详细介绍MySQL中的增删改语句以及常用方
    的头像 发表于 11-16 15:36 604次阅读

    数据库mysql基本增删改

    的基本增删改查操作。 一、增加数据(INSERT) 在MySQL中,可以使用INSERT语句来向数据库中添加
    的头像 发表于 11-16 16:35 973次阅读

    mysql数据库增删改查基本语句

    MySQL是一种关系型数据库管理系统,提供了丰富的功能和语法,来支持数据增删改查。在本文中,将详细介绍MySQL
    的头像 发表于 11-16 16:36 527次阅读